Axial Leaded and Cartridge Fuses: An Overview

Fuses play a critical role in electrical safety, and among the various types available, axial leaded and cartridge fuses stand out for their specific applications. These fuses are designed to protect equipment by interrupting power in the event of an overcurrent, acting as a sacrificial device to provide overcurrent protection.

Understanding Axial Leaded Fuses

Axial leaded fuses are characterized by their cylindrical shape and metal wires extending from both ends, designed for through-hole mounting on printed circuit boards (PCBs). These fuses are preferred for their compact footprint and reliable protection in electronic applications. They are available in various sizes and ratings to accommodate different circuit requirements.

Cartridge Fuses Explained

In contrast, cartridge fuses are typically larger and encased in a cartridge made of glass, ceramic, or other materials. They are intended for applications requiring higher current ratings and are often used in conjunction with a fuse holder or clips. The robust design of cartridge fuses makes them suitable for more demanding environments.

Applications and Features

Both axial leaded and cartridge fuses find their applications in a variety of sectors, including industrial controls, automotive systems, and consumer electronics. Their features include a defined breaking capacity, which is crucial for the safety and longevity of electrical systems. The breaking capacity indicates the maximum current the fuse can safely interrupt without damage to the circuit.

Materials and Advantages

The materials used in axial leaded and cartridge fuses contribute to their functionality and durability. For instance, the use of glass or ceramic in cartridge fuses enhances their ability to withstand high temperatures and currents. One of the primary advantages of these fuses is their maintenance-free nature, as they do not require regular servicing or parts replacement, unlike some electromechanical protective devices.

Selecting the Right Fuse

When selecting axial leaded and cartridge fuses, it is essential to consider the current rating, which should align with the nominal amperage of the circuit. Additionally, the interrupting rating of the fuse must meet or exceed the potential short circuit current to ensure proper protection.
